Searching for Autism in our Social Brain
Jan 21, 2020•10 min
Episode description
Biological anthropologist Katerina Semendeferi describes how the human brain's extraordinary powers of social cognition may predispose only humans to conditions like autism and how she aids the search for the neurophysiology underlying these conditions.
